Gentoo Archives: gentoo-commits

From: Andreas Sturmlechner <asturm@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: media-gfx/krita/
Date: Sun, 23 Feb 2020 11:44:42
Message-Id: 1582458256.f4170bd8879015c764add3d83b4755cb051349b1.asturm@gentoo
1 commit: f4170bd8879015c764add3d83b4755cb051349b1
2 Author: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
3 AuthorDate: Sun Feb 23 11:42:33 2020 +0000
4 Commit: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org>
5 CommitDate: Sun Feb 23 11:44:16 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=f4170bd8
7
8 media-gfx/krita: Drop 4.2.8.2-r1
9
10 Package-Manager: Portage-2.3.89, Repoman-2.3.20
11 Signed-off-by: Andreas Sturmlechner <asturm <AT> gentoo.org>
12
13 media-gfx/krita/krita-4.2.8.2-r1.ebuild | 116 --------------------------------
14 1 file changed, 116 deletions(-)
15
16 diff --git a/media-gfx/krita/krita-4.2.8.2-r1.ebuild b/media-gfx/krita/krita-4.2.8.2-r1.ebuild
17 deleted file mode 100644
18 index 2348b287dfb..00000000000
19 --- a/media-gfx/krita/krita-4.2.8.2-r1.ebuild
20 +++ /dev/null
21 @@ -1,116 +0,0 @@
22 -# Copyright 1999-2020 Gentoo Authors
23 -# Distributed under the terms of the GNU General Public License v2
24 -
25 -EAPI=7
26 -
27 -ECM_TEST="forceoptional-recursive"
28 -PYTHON_COMPAT=( python3_{6,7,8} )
29 -KFMIN=5.60.0
30 -QTMIN=5.12.3
31 -VIRTUALX_REQUIRED="test"
32 -inherit ecm kde.org python-single-r1
33 -
34 -if [[ ${KDE_BUILD_TYPE} = release ]]; then
35 - SRC_URI="mirror://kde/stable/${PN}/$(ver_cut 1-3)/${P}.tar.xz"
36 - KEYWORDS="~amd64 ~x86"
37 -fi
38 -
39 -DESCRIPTION="Free digital painting application. Digital Painting, Creative Freedom!"
40 -HOMEPAGE="https://kde.org/applications/graphics/krita/ https://krita.org/"
41 -
42 -LICENSE="GPL-3"
43 -SLOT="5"
44 -IUSE="color-management fftw gif +gsl heif +jpeg openexr pdf qtmedia +raw tiff vc"
45 -REQUIRED_USE="${PYTHON_REQUIRED_USE}"
46 -
47 -BDEPEND="
48 - dev-cpp/eigen:3
49 - dev-lang/perl
50 - sys-devel/gettext
51 -"
52 -RDEPEND="${PYTHON_DEPS}
53 - dev-libs/boost:=
54 - dev-libs/quazip
55 - $(python_gen_cond_dep '
56 - dev-python/PyQt5[${PYTHON_MULTI_USEDEP}]
57 - dev-python/sip[${PYTHON_MULTI_USEDEP}]
58 - ')
59 - >=dev-qt/qtconcurrent-${QTMIN}:5
60 - >=dev-qt/qtdbus-${QTMIN}:5
61 - >=dev-qt/qtdeclarative-${QTMIN}:5
62 - >=dev-qt/qtgui-${QTMIN}:5=[-gles2]
63 - >=dev-qt/qtnetwork-${QTMIN}:5
64 - >=dev-qt/qtprintsupport-${QTMIN}:5
65 - >=dev-qt/qtsvg-${QTMIN}:5
66 - >=dev-qt/qtwidgets-${QTMIN}:5
67 - >=dev-qt/qtx11extras-${QTMIN}:5
68 - >=dev-qt/qtxml-${QTMIN}:5
69 - >=kde-frameworks/karchive-${KFMIN}:5
70 - >=kde-frameworks/kcompletion-${KFMIN}:5
71 - >=kde-frameworks/kconfig-${KFMIN}:5
72 - >=kde-frameworks/kcoreaddons-${KFMIN}:5
73 - >=kde-frameworks/kcrash-${KFMIN}:5
74 - >=kde-frameworks/kguiaddons-${KFMIN}:5
75 - >=kde-frameworks/ki18n-${KFMIN}:5
76 - >=kde-frameworks/kiconthemes-${KFMIN}:5
77 - >=kde-frameworks/kitemmodels-${KFMIN}:5
78 - >=kde-frameworks/kitemviews-${KFMIN}:5
79 - >=kde-frameworks/kwidgetsaddons-${KFMIN}:5
80 - >=kde-frameworks/kwindowsystem-${KFMIN}:5
81 - >=kde-frameworks/kxmlgui-${KFMIN}:5
82 - media-gfx/exiv2:=
83 - media-libs/lcms
84 - media-libs/libpng:0=
85 - sys-libs/zlib
86 - virtual/opengl
87 - x11-libs/libX11
88 - x11-libs/libXi
89 - color-management? ( media-libs/opencolorio )
90 - fftw? ( sci-libs/fftw:3.0= )
91 - gif? ( media-libs/giflib )
92 - gsl? ( sci-libs/gsl:= )
93 - jpeg? ( virtual/jpeg:0 )
94 - heif? ( media-libs/libheif:= )
95 - openexr? (
96 - media-libs/ilmbase:=
97 - media-libs/openexr
98 - )
99 - pdf? ( app-text/poppler[qt5] )
100 - qtmedia? ( >=dev-qt/qtmultimedia-${QTMIN}:5 )
101 - raw? ( media-libs/libraw:= )
102 - tiff? ( media-libs/tiff:0 )
103 -"
104 -DEPEND="${RDEPEND}
105 - vc? ( >=dev-libs/vc-1.1.0 )
106 -"
107 -
108 -# bug 630508
109 -RESTRICT+=" test"
110 -
111 -pkg_setup() {
112 - python-single-r1_pkg_setup
113 - ecm_pkg_setup
114 -}
115 -
116 -src_configure() {
117 - # Prevent sandbox violation from FindPyQt5.py module
118 - # See Gentoo-bug 655918
119 - addpredict /dev/dri
120 -
121 - local mycmakeargs=(
122 - $(cmake_use_find_package color-management OCIO)
123 - $(cmake_use_find_package fftw FFTW3)
124 - $(cmake_use_find_package gif GIF)
125 - $(cmake_use_find_package gsl GSL)
126 - $(cmake_use_find_package heif HEIF)
127 - $(cmake_use_find_package jpeg JPEG)
128 - $(cmake_use_find_package openexr OpenEXR)
129 - $(cmake_use_find_package pdf Poppler)
130 - $(cmake_use_find_package qtmedia Qt5Multimedia)
131 - $(cmake_use_find_package raw LibRaw)
132 - $(cmake_use_find_package tiff TIFF)
133 - $(cmake_use_find_package vc Vc)
134 - )
135 -
136 - ecm_src_configure
137 -}